## Environment Variables: Encoding Detection

The Birchmoor upload service sniffs the encoding of user-submitted text files before parsing. New team members should set ENCODING_DETECT_MODE=strict locally so malformed files fail loudly rather than silently transcoding. Confidence thresholds live in ENCODING_MIN_CONFIDENCE (default 0.85). Detection results are cached in the Saltfen store, which requires authentication, so add its access credential on the following line:

sealed setting: ARCHIVE_KEY3=8d0

Ticket: Vault lockout blocking Thornlet image-slimming pipeline

The Thornlet slimming job strips debug layers before images ship, but it can't pull the signing material — the Copperfell vault sealed itself after three failed auth attempts overnight. Builds are queued, nothing shipping oversized, just stalled. Security review needed before unseal. Approved reviewer should unseal the vault with the recovery passphrase below.

unlock words, yawig-kagef: gordor-holvan-ulaael-pramir-ulaiel-tamdor

Subject: Write-down heads-up before the quarterly call

Hi all,

Quick note before Friday: we're taking a write-down on the Glimmerline lamp stock that's been sitting in the Harwick depot since spring. Demand never recovered after the Pellan redesign, so finance is marking it down about 40%. Branch managers, please flag any remaining units so we can clear them in one sweep. Tessa will share the mechanics next week. Context on where this fits in our wider plans is below.

management briefing: Headcount on the Quenael team goes from 9 to 80 by the end of July. Gross margin on Quenael came in at 15 percent against a plan of 20 percent.

## Service Accounts — DeployParrot Bot

DeployParrot posts deploy status into team channels via the internal Chatterline relay. It runs under the svc-parrot service account, which has read-only access to the Shipyard pipeline API. Maintainers should rotate its credentials every 90 days; the rotation script handles channel re-auth automatically. The relay authenticates with the key shown below:

app token of hahaf-bawef = qvz11-DmoznhUce1e